Horror
Horror is a unique experience to me. I hate ghost, demon or darkness, yet I still watch them. Therefore it was quite unique to me, especially when my curiousity constantly pulls me back to the world of horror, even if I fear them. Indeed,
the aim of horror was to inflict fear, however we seems to enjoy the fear as a thrill, an excitement. We can call these
as masochist. In my case though, it is less likely to be the thrill that captivates me, rather it is the curiousity. I
want to know what kind of fear I will experience and how does the *horror* looks like. It seems pretty weird when it causes me to have nightmares, and yet I still watch them.
I am aware of the different level of horror and only horror of certain level will inflict much impact on me, thus sometimes I have the courage to watch horror show, hoping that the fear level isn't high enough to cause me with nightmares which I detest. However, mood does affect our fear tolerance. When I am not feeling too well, or I am feeling quite cloudy, my state of mind is pretty unstable and thus, reducing my fear tolerance. This led to even the simplest form of horror to haunt me through the night. Thus the factor of fear in horror depends on each individual level of tolerance, as well as their mood and also, the horror's level of fear.
Gore is also a form of horror, however it is a horror based on disgust and fear of the gore scene happening to yourselves. Seeing gore scene can be disturbing and hurt one's mind, however it also pumps the adrenaline within us. The excitement gained from seeing things we do not see or rather things we might never see in real life, is comparable to having an intense horror show. Thus gore and horror are somewhat similar, especially based on their impact on a person's mentality, and also giving out excitement through fear, hatred and disgust.
